Last Will and Testament We, the Seniors of 1970, being of sound mind and body, declare the following of our last will and testament. I, Marilyn Bentley, will my height and big mouth to the student body. There's plenty to go around! I, Garon Boyd, will all of my charm and rebounding power to Bobby Lane III. I, Judy Brinson, will my quiet ways to Sharon Hosey. I, Linda Bundy, will to Margaret Bundy (my sister) my good taste in soft drinks, (Hop'n Gator). I, James Bush (Sleepy), will my privilege of keeping banking hours to Alonzo Young. Use your time wisely' I, Allen Clark, will my nervous, drumming fingers to Mrs. Kilpatrick. I, Jerry Cooper, will my ability as a hunter to Jimmie Brantley, so she can keep up with her boyfriends. I, Mike Cooper, will my like for long hair to Mr. James Revell. I, Frances Crawford, will my ability to talk in Math class and still ijiake passing grades to Joyce Rudd. I, Mary Edwards, will my freckles to Glenda Taylor. I, Calvin Essman, will to Wayne Miley my ability to tear up three cars in one year. I, Jesse Essman, will the name and address of my barber to Richard Johnson and to Charles Howell so they may go by for an estimate on a haircut. I, Clark Fletcher, will my car, White Lighting to my beloved sister Pearl. I, Leslie Haire, will my ability to spell to my sister, Jennifer. I, Rosa Hogan, will my forty-two hips to Linda Grandberry. I, Alzada Jackson, will to Bertha Kelly my ability to be slim and trim. I, William Glenn Johnson, will my ability to go up town every day second period and at lunch and never get caught to James Faircloth. I, Raymond March, (Spud), will to Johnny Kelly a package of cigarettes and a set of instructions as to how to avoid Coach when smoking. I, Wayne Marriott, will my '57 Chevy to Tommy Fletcher to aid in his search for new girls since he has run out of them at Greensboro. I, Annette Oliver, will my ability to make good grades without studying to Marion March. She needs it! I, Barbara Parker, will my ability to play volleyball to Sharon Young. I, Nell Peters, will my curly hair to Mary Aleen Hunt. I, Norma Potter, will my Squaw Woman,” image to my sister, Barbara. I, Bruce Rowan, will my job at Fletcher Company to Roy Fletcher. I, Jane Smith, will my Volkswagen, Herbie, to Debra Sewell. I, Susan Smith, will my seat belts and shoulder harnesses to LaRae Clark and Christine Phillips to keep them restrained while turning corners. 23
